I am submitting an application for naturalisation and there is a question about previous immigration applications to the UK.
I have an ILR through the 5 year route and held another work visa before that which does not count towards ILR.
Do I have to submit details of all previous immigration applications ever made?
I don't have the records of application and appointment dates for those.

Yes, all previous applications (except visitor visas).
Provide as many details as you can - approximate month/year is fine.
Some boxes are "if known" anyway. It's not an issue that could jeopardise your application.

I have progressed filling the applications but have a few more points I am looking for help on

1. Can the same 2 referees be used for the family? (parents and children). In my case, all of us got the ILR at the same time and hence applying for naturalisation together. Yes

2. Does the criteria of being part of a chartered/professional body matter as long as the referees are British nationals over 25 yrs of age? One of them is a manager in limited company. Yes it does apply. One referee needs to be a professional on the approved list.

3. I heard that one of the referees for a child should be someone who have worked with that child in a professional capacity (e.g.teacher) but we are unable to get one to agree. Will it affect the application? No. This is a well known issue to UKVI. Explain in a cover letter that you have asked teachers and they refused.

4. Is Passport enough for proof of living in the UK? Passports do not have UK entry stamp for the last one year now that the border control have done away with it. Should I give P60s or letters from employers? Passports are enough.
